LONDON (Reuters) - Swiss-based bank UBS AG (UBSN.VX) named Ian Gladman and Edouard de Vitry as co-heads of financial institutions (FIG) coverage for Europe, the Middle-East and Africa at its investment bank.

The two, who are already at the bank and covering financial institutions, have replaced David Soanes, who is heading up the bank's Global Capital Markets group, UBS said on Tuesday. They are based in London and report to John Cryan, the bank's global head of FIG.

Separately the bank said Philippe Sacerdot, head of European banking coverage, will become a vice chairman of the investment bank and as such will work as a senior banker with the firm's clients in the area. He will also report to Cryan.
